AXForum  
Go Back   AXForum > Microsoft Dynamics AX > DAX: Программирование
All
Forgotten Your Password?
Register Forum Rules FAQ Members List Today's Posts Search

 
 
Thread Tools Search this Thread Display Modes
Old 19.05.2006, 19:04   #1  
murad is offline
murad
Участник
 
55 / 10 (1) +
Join Date: 05.10.2005
? Где используются классы с названиями Ax* ?
Собственно вопрос.

В Аксапте я начинающий, но наткнувшись на статью
http://msdn.microsoft.com/mbs/defaul...xsalesdemo.asp
подумал, что они-то как раз и используются для доступа к Аксапте через ComConnector извне.

До недавнего времени я обходился просто Query, QueryRun и проч
Old 19.05.2006, 23:47   #2  
mazzy is offline
mazzy
Участник
mazzy's Avatar
Лучший по профессии 2015
Лучший по профессии 2014
Лучший по профессии AXAWARD 2013
Лучший по профессии 2011
Лучший по профессии 2009
 
29,472 / 4494 (208) ++++++++++
Join Date: 29.11.2001
Location: Москва
Blog Entries: 10
А фиг его знает...
В самой Аксапте ax классы являются обертками над таблицами.
Эти классы используются только в CommerceGateway для общения с BizTalk.

Вообще говоря, ComConnector может прекрасно обходится и без классов-оберток.
См. описание интерфейса IAxaptaRecord в руководстве разработчика.

Просто в данной конкретной статье зачем то начали использовать оберточные классы...

Оберточные классы всем хороши. И вообще говоря, работать с ними удобнее, чем с интерфейсом... Но мало кто при добавлении полей в таблицы будет добавлять соответствующие методы в оберточные классы...
__________________
полезное на axForum, github, vk, coub.
This post has been rated by: murad (1).
Old 21.05.2006, 19:56   #3  
EVGL is offline
EVGL
Banned
Соотечественники
Лучший по профессии 2017
Лучший по профессии 2015
Лучший по профессии 2014
 
4,445 / 3001 (0) ++++++++++
Join Date: 09.07.2002
Location: Parndorf, AT
Quote:
Originally Posted by mazzy
В самой Аксапте ax классы являются обертками над таблицами.
Эти классы используются только в CommerceGateway для общения с BizTalk.
Ну, не только... Используются повсеместно для эмуляции методов modifiedField(): в Enterprize Portal при изменении заказа, в CommerceGateway и в Intercompany, при дуплицировании полей из заголовка заказа в строки, в самом вызове SalesLine.modifiedField(), SalesTable.modifiedField().

Использовать эти классы для импорта внешних данных, для интеграции - хороший стиль, но только технически очень накладно и не несет явных преимуществ.
 

Similar Threads
Thread Thread Starter Forum Replies Last Post
Где перекрыт метод в классе miklenew DAX: База знаний и проекты 5 29.05.2008 11:07
Где работают like'и? Mechanizm DAX: Программирование 4 16.04.2004 11:33
Axapta 3.0 - можно ли править классы в USR слое AKIS DAX: Программирование 3 07.02.2004 01:19
Где отчёт?... 2b4fITin DAX: Программирование 1 18.09.2003 20:46
3.0: где активировать цены по скл. аналитикам ? Zabr DAX: Функционал 5 20.06.2003 11:12

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Рейтинг@Mail.ru
All times are GMT +3. The time now is 01:48.
Powered by vBulletin® Version 3.8.5
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Contacts E-mail, Advertising.